What a first-time founder’s landing page must do (and not do)

For a first-time founder, knowing what to do on your new landing page helps you save time and effort, especially if you aim to go live fast.

Here are 4 tips to consider:

1. One primary goal (email capture, demo request, preorder)

Every new landing page needs a single job. Whether it’s collecting emails, booking demos, or securing preorders through capture forms, everything on the page should point to that action.

That’s why when founders try to make a page do five things at once, nothing converts. A focused goal makes even simple landing page templates feel intentional.

2. Message clarity over features

A strong landing page design explains who your target audience is and what problem it solves before the listing features. Visitors don’t need a full roadmap; they only need to know if this is a fit for them. You get better results with your AI landing page once you strip back the fluff and sharpen the message.

3. Social proof + risk reversal

A professional landing page builds trust quickly. Short testimonials, client logos, or usage stats reassure visitors that you have experience in your industry and have experience in working with past clients.

Pair that with a risk-reversal strategy, such as a free trial or a money-back guarantee, to minimize the hesitation from potential customers. These trust signals work well with AI-generated copy because they add human weight.

4. Avoid: too many CTAs, vague promises, no “who it’s for”

This is where founders stumble. Multiple calls-to-action (CTAs) compete for attention, while vague promises feel empty. And pages that never define the target audience leave visitors guessing.

Keep one clear action, be specific, and say who the page is meant for. When you create landing pages, restraint matters more than extra AI features or flashy design tools.

Step-by-step: build a landing page with an AI generator

Learn how to create a landing page with an AI landing page generator using these 7 quick steps:

Step 1: Define ICP + one pain + one outcome

Before you draft your AI landing page, get clear on who you’re building it for. Start by defining your target audience through an Ideal Customer Profile (ICP), then identify one sharp pain they deal with daily and one outcome they actually want.

Step 2: Draft your offer + CTA

Next, draft your offer with clarity in mind, stripping away any ambiguity. Whether you’re offering a checklist, demo, early access, or a paid pilot, one thing should be certain: it has to be concrete.

Pair this with a call to action that matches the intent, such as “Start your free trial now” or “Get early access.” This step sets the direction for your website copy and where to place the CTAs across the landing page.

Step 3: Generate the first draft with AI

Now, share your inputs into the AI landing page generator in the form of a prompt, and within seconds, it can create new landing pages. The way this works is that the AI analyzes your prompt using natural language processing to understand your intent.

Step 4: Edit for specificity (numbers, timeframe, proof)

Use words that convey a sense of specificity about your business, including the number of clients you have helped, the timeframe involved, and proof of outcome. This builds credibility and trust, which in turn helps increase conversions.

Avoid using vague and generic phrases like “fast setup” or “supported many clients.” For instance, if you run a service-based business like a bookkeeping firm, you might say, “Helped 200+ small businesses reduce monthly reporting time by 40% in the first 30 days.”

Step 5: Add trust (FAQ, testimonials, logos, security)

Adding a few trust elements to your landing page can ease doubts and help visitors feel more comfortable. A short FAQ can handle common objections, real testimonials show you’re legit, recognizable logos add instant credibility, and security cues like SSL badges reassure people their info is safe.

Visitors want reassurance they’re not engaging in something sketchy. You don’t need to pile everything on your landing page; covering the basics is enough.

Step 6: Add conversion tools (form, calendar, payments if relevant)

To convert potential customers, a landing page should include the right tools. Add capture forms, booking calendars, or payment buttons, if relevant. Make sure these are connected to your email marketing platforms, so follow-ups occur automatically.

Step 7: Publish + measure

A founder-friendly prompt template (copy/paste)

A good prompt shapes everything the AI writes.

Here’s a prompt template, along with some examples that first-time founders can reuse when creating landing pages:

  • Prompt template

“Create a landing page for [product or service]. The target audience is [ICP]. Their main pain is [pain]. The outcome they want is [result]. Our differentiator is [why us]. CTA: [action]. Tone: clear, friendly, credible.”

  • Prompt example for SaaS founder

“Create a startup landing page builder page for a B2B SaaS that helps agencies manage client intake. Target audience: small agencies. Pain: messy onboarding. Outcome: faster setup. Differentiator: built-in forms and automation. CTA: Book a demo.”

  • Prompt example for service business

“Create a professional landing page for a bookkeeping service. Audience: freelancers. Pain: time lost on finances. Outcome: peace of mind. Differentiator: flat monthly pricing. CTA: Get a quote.”

  • Prompt example for creator or newsletter

“Create a page for a weekly newsletter. Audience: early founders. Pain: scattered advice. Outcome: clear guidance. Differentiator: real-world examples. CTA: Subscribe free.”

9 conversion audits to run before you share the link

To boost conversions on your landing page, it’s essential to run some conversion audits. Here are 9 steps to follow before you start sharing your landing page link:

1. Above the fold

Show your main benefit or outcome right at the top so visitors see it immediately. This helps them know why your page matters without scrolling.

2. CTA copy

Your call-to-action should tell people exactly what to do, like “Start your free trial” or “Book a demo.” Make it simple and tied to the result they’ll get.

3. Form friction

Ask only for the information you really need, like name and email. Too many fields can make visitors give up before signing up.

4. Mobile devices

Check that your landing page looks good and works on any screen, from phones to tablets. Most visitors will leave if it’s hard to use on mobile.

5. Speed

Your page should load fast, even if someone has a slow internet connection. Slow pages frustrate people and hurt conversion rates.

6. Proof density

Show trust signals like real testimonials or recognizable logos, but don’t crowd the page. A few well-placed examples go further than a wall of text.

7. Pricing clarity

Make your pricing clear and upfront so visitors aren’t surprised later. People trust pages that are honest about costs.

8. Objections

Use FAQs to answer the most common questions or concerns visitors might have. This helps reduce hesitation and makes people feel more confident.

9. SEO basics

Add clear meta tags, readable headers, and a structure that search engines can crawl. This helps your landing page get found by the target audience you want.

Common AI landing page mistakes (and fixes)

Even with the best AI landing page generator, it’s easy to make mistakes that hurt conversions. Here are some common slip-ups and how to fix them so your page actually works for your target audience.

1. Generic copy

Landing pages sometimes feel like everyone else’s because the text is too broad or boring. Make it yours by adding specific details, examples, and a voice that matches your brand.

2. No “why trust us”

Visitors want to know they can rely on you. Add simple trust signals like frequently asked questions (FAQs), real testimonials, logos, or security badges so people feel safe taking action.

3. Design-first, no story

Some founders focus on making things look pretty before explaining what their product really does. Start with your message first, then use design elements to support it, not replace it.

4. No tracking or follow-up

If you don’t track what’s happening on your page, you’re guessing what works. Connect your landing page to Google Analytics or built-in reporting, and make sure follow-ups like emails happen automatically.
